Government Tender Compliance Requirements: What Gets You Disqualified

LuciusAI Team·December 28, 2025·10 min read

The most brilliant proposal in the world is worthless if it fails compliance. Here are the most common reasons tenders are rejected — and every one of them is avoidable.

Administrative Failures (Instant Disqualification)

  • Late submission — even by one minute. Portals lock at the deadline. No exceptions.
  • Wrong format — submitting a PDF when they asked for Word, or exceeding the file size limit
  • Missing signatures — anti-collusion declarations, Modern Slavery statements, or director sign-off
  • Incomplete forms — leaving mandatory fields blank or writing "N/A" where a substantive answer was required
  • Wrong portal — emailing a bid when the instructions said "submit via the e-procurement portal only"

Financial & Legal Failures

  • Insufficient turnover — most contracts require annual turnover of at least 2x the annual contract value
  • Inadequate insurance — professional indemnity, public liability, and employer's liability all need to meet minimum thresholds
  • Exclusion grounds — failing to declare previous convictions, tax non-compliance, or conflicts of interest
  • Expired certifications — attaching an ISO certificate that lapsed 3 months ago

Technical & Quality Failures

  • Not answering the question asked — writing about your company when they asked about your methodology
  • Exceeding word counts — evaluators may stop reading or score zero beyond the stated limit
  • Generic, non-specific responses — "We have extensive experience" without naming projects, dates, or outcomes
  • Missing the Social Value section — with a minimum 10% weighting, this alone can eliminate you
  • Ignoring evaluation criteria weightings — spending 3 pages on a 5% criterion and 1 page on a 40% criterion

How to Avoid These Failures

Create a compliance checklist for every bid. Before writing starts, extract every mandatory requirement and pass/fail criterion from the tender document. Check off each item as you complete it. Have a second pair of eyes do a final compliance review 24 hours before submission.
